A Guide to Kansas Laws on Guardianship and Conservatorship Kansas Guardianship Program KGP. The act for obtaining a guardian or conservator, or both, is found in Kansas statutes annotated 59-3050 through 59-3096. This publication reflects statutory revisions through the 2008 Kansas Legislative Session. It is intended to be an overview and general Guide and the information contained herein should not be taken in lieu of specific advice. The KGP is a partnership involving the State of Kansas and its citizen volunteers. The program recruits, trains and monitors volunteers who serve as court appointed guardians or conservators.
